Welcome to 40k!
Don't rush to buy too much, if you can help it. Even if you've read up as much as you can on a particular unit or something... see if you can try them out in a game before buying them by proxying them in a practice game with some friends. Planned tactics and theory are cool and all but sometimes you don't find certain quirks until you've applied it on the field.
Good luck! Have fun!

Welcome! The only advice I have is keep going on the painting (it can be frustrating at first, but then there's that moment where something looks cool!) As to Tau or Tyranid...think this way, one is best at staying back maneuvering and shooting, while the second is a rush to grip with the enemy. So maybe play some games with proxies or watch (there's a lot of great battle reports videotaped here) and decide which might fit your play style.
